So to be clear...I'm wanting a water fed pole for 2 purposes, 1) windows, gutters/fascia 2) as an extension for large roofs, running the SH through it with a jet tip. Can I run the SH through the lines without contaminating/damaging the water lines?

Never run SH though a WF pole. Always use a line outside the pole and just spin the pole once extended to keep from tangles. AC makes and adapter and hose that we use
